摘要
The use of rapid prototyping has become a useful tool to help and support medical activities. It can be used as an auxiliary tool for the diagnosis of certain diseases and the development of complex surgical procedures. The aim of this paper is to show the use of a Rapid Prototype model to help visualize the anatomical structures in an orthopedics case. A virtual 3D model was created from Computer Tomography images using the Invesalius software. After that, a physical model was created using a 3DP machine. The patient and the medical team would discuss this surgical procedure using the images and the biomodel. The main purpose of the prototype model was to introduce the idea of a new educational environment using RP to clarify the complexity of this procedure for both doctors and patient.
